Manchester City Secures Comfortable Win at Selhurst Park
London, England – Manchester City secured a dominant victory over Crystal Palace at Selhurst Park, showcasing their Premier League prowess. Pep Guardiola’s side controlled the match with 62% possession, creating clear opportunities against a Crystal Palace team that fought hard but was ultimately outmatched.
Erling Haaland opened the scoring in the 41st minute, following an excellent assist from Matheus Nunes, giving City the lead going into halftime. The second half continued with City’s dominance, and Phil Foden extended the lead in the 69th minute, thanks to a precise pass from Rayan Cherki.
Despite Crystal Palace’s efforts, which included two yellow cards and nine fouls, they failed to seriously threaten City’s goal. Haaland sealed his brace by converting a penalty in the 88th minute, consolidating the victory for Manchester City.
Although Crystal Palace attempted to respond, they only managed four shots on target out of their 16 attempts. Manchester City, on the other hand, demonstrated their efficiency with six shots, all directed towards the opposing goal.
